This course delves into fundamental questions about human nature, the influences of genetics versus environment, and the processes of development that shape our lives.
The course begins with an overview of what developmental psychology encompasses, addressing the various age groups it studies and the significance of understanding ‘development.’ It emphasizes the importance of recognizing the rules governing ‘occurrence,’ ‘development,’ and ‘change’ in human life.
One of the most compelling aspects of this course is its exploration of the philosophical foundations and debates within developmental psychology. It tackles the age-old question of whether human development is primarily driven by innate factors or environmental influences. By examining both Western philosophical thought and ancient Chinese texts, the course provides a rich context for understanding these differing perspectives.
The course also introduces two major views on development: the continuous view, which sees development as a gradual accumulation of experiences, and the discontinuous view, which posits that development involves significant qualitative changes. This duality is crucial for understanding individual differences in development, as some differences remain stable while others evolve over time.
Methodologically, the course addresses the challenges of studying infants and children, who often cannot articulate their thoughts or feelings. It presents various research designs tailored to capture the perceptual, cognitive, linguistic, and socio-emotional development of young individuals. The course also covers longitudinal, cross-sectional, and sequential designs, providing insights into how to effectively gather data across different age groups while minimizing generational and temporal biases.
